Understanding OEM vs. Aftermarket Parts
Before diving into particular elements, it is valuable to understand the fundamental difference in between OEM and aftermarket parts.
- OEM Parts: These are manufactured by Mopar-- the main service, parts, and customer-care company for Stellantis (parent business of Dodge and Ram). OEM parts are similar to the parts set up on the vehicle when it rolled off the assembly line.
- Aftermarket Parts: These are produced by third-party companies. While in some cases more economical, they are designed to fit a large range of makes and designs, or they represent a third party's interpretation of how a specific part need to be constructed.

The Role of OEM Parts in Diesel Ram Trucks
Owners of Ram trucks equipped with the legendary 6.7 L Cummins Turbo Diesel engine face even greater stakes when it concerns replacement parts. Modern diesel motor are marvels of accuracy engineering, counting on sophisticated fuel injection systems, emissions controls (DEF/DPF systems), and turbochargers.
Utilizing aftermarket fuel filters or sensors on a Cummins-powered Ram can cause devastating fuel system contamination or check-engine lights that are notoriously hard to identify. Sticking strictly to Mopar OEM filters and engine components guarantees that fuel pressure, filtering micron ratings, and electronic interactions remain within factory tolerances.

How do I discover the appropriate part number for my Ram truck?
The most precise way to discover the best part is by utilizing your truck's Vehicle Identification Number (VIN). Dealership parts departments and online OEM catalogs use your VIN to bring up the specific build sheet for your specific trim, year, and engine setup.
